Output 51348a0384f5f558b07316e33811e8101232c1dd820db66bd8d7d5381907c8d0:0

value
36616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943f6d0163b9985df601c322a2d14cb948088001 OP_EQUAL
address
3FCsuqUoj5ZxntCgLgFrRJ8bS1pM6atFhD
transaction
51348a0384f5f558b07316e33811e8101232c1dd820db66bd8d7d5381907c8d0
spent
true